Memories of the Nghe An Newspaper Cup from the Song Lam Nghe An striker.
The goal against Becamex TP.HCM solidified Ngo Van Luong's mark in the Song Lam Nghe An jersey. Few know that this midfielder's journey began in the Nghe An Newspaper Cup.
The decisive goal
In the crucial match at Go Dau Stadium, when SLNA was under immense pressure after a series of unsuccessful games, Ngo Van Luong once again knew how to shine at the right moment.
In the 51st minute of the match, from a quick counter-attack on the right wing, Michael Olaha delivered a perfectly placed cross. Inside the box, Ngo Van Luong made a clever run and unleashed a powerful header, sending the ball into the far corner of the net, leaving the opposing goalkeeper helpless.

That moment fully showcased Ngo Van Luong's most outstanding qualities. A player who doesn't possess an ideal physique, but always knows how to make a difference with his technique, cunning, and ability to handle the ball in tight spaces.
After four seasons competing in the V.League, the midfielder from Nam Dan is having what is considered his most successful season with SLNA. In the 2025/26 season, Ngo Van Luong played 24 matches, totaling 1,496 minutes of playing time, and scored 3 goals. More importantly, most of those goals came at crucial moments for the Nghe An team.
Not only contributing to the team's goalscoring, Van Luong has also become a crucial link in coach Van Sy Son's tactical system. Playing primarily on the left wing, the 2001-born player stands out thanks to his dribbling ability, skillful ball handling, and ability to create breakthroughs with his speedy runs.
Despite being only 1.72m tall, Van Luong always knows how to utilize his agility and technique to gain an advantage over his opponents. His quick footwork, dribbling, and acceleration have become familiar sights of this player in the SLNA jersey.
What's even more valuable is Van Luong's dedication. Despite suffering an injury this season, he made a strong comeback and maintained consistent form during the team's most challenging period.

“This is my last season as a young player, so I always want to contribute as much as possible to SLNA. My contract is also about to expire, so I have a lot of emotions and thoughts about the future. Therefore, scoring an important goal that helped the team secure early survival is something that makes me very happy and proud. For me, contributing to my hometown team is always the most special thing,” – Ngo Van Luong shared.
Perhaps that's why fans in Nghe An always have a special affection for the midfielder from Nam Dan. With Van Luong's contract with SLNA nearing its end, many fans still hope he will stay and continue to play for his hometown team.
Beautiful memories of the Nghe An Newspaper Cup
Few people know that Ngo Van Luong's journey into professional football began when he accompanied his older brother to play in the Nghe An Newspaper Cup Youth and Children's Football Tournament.
Back then, the boy from Nam Dan never imagined he would become a professional football player. Van Luong simply followed his older brother to the district's football field to watch and play with the others. But that very field marked the biggest turning point in his life.
Recalling his early days participating in the Nghe An Newspaper Cup, Ngo Van Luong said: "Back then, I followed my older brother to play for the district and the coaches let me try playing. At first, I just watched from the sidelines, but after seeing that I could play well, the coaches encouraged me to join the game."
From a boy who "played for fun," Van Luong quickly impressed with his agility, skill, and natural ball-handling ability. His performances at the Nghe An Newspaper Cup in 2011 caught the eye of SLNA scouts.

What's remarkable is that at that time, Van Luong's Nam Dan team wasn't among the teams that advanced far in the tournament. However, the talent of the boy born in 2001 was still discovered by scouts. Van Luong recalled: "From the time I played for the district team, the SLNA coaches had already noticed me. After the tournament, I was called for a tryout."
It can be said that the Nghe An Newspaper Cup Youth and Children's Football Tournament was the first gateway that led Ngo Van Luong to professional football. Without that platform, perhaps Nghe An football would not have discovered such a technically gifted and passionate player as he is today.
For Van Luong, the Nghe An Newspaper Cup holds special childhood memories. It was the first time the boy from Nam Dan traveled far with the team, experienced group activities, and felt the atmosphere of a real tournament.
"Playing in the Newspaper Cup was so much fun. After the match, we got to hang out and eat ice cream with the coach and my teammates. For me, those are very memorable memories," Văn Lương shared.
Now, Ngo Van Luong has become a key player for the Nghe An team in the V.League. And it's remarkable that this player, who rose through the ranks of the Nghe An Newspaper Cup, scored the crucial goal that helped SLNA secure their place in the league early this season.
